My name is Casey and I am a Healthy Homes Navigator For Saint Vincent De Paul. I am pleased to extend an offer for a free Healthy Homes Assessment for your living space. Our team of experts will thoroughly evaluate your home for compliance with the Healthy Homes Standards, covering key areas such as insulation, heating, ventilation, moisture ingress, and draught stopping. This assessment aims to identify any potential health hazards or non-compliance issues to ensure your home meets the required standards for optimal health and safety. We can help with tips and recommendations on how to make and keep your home warmer this winter and every winter after that. We can assist you with our services that come with the program.
